Hamas Frees Last American Hostage Edan Alexander After 580 Days

The 21-year-old Israeli-American soldier was handed over to the Red Cross and is undergoing medical evaluation before reuniting with his family and traveling to meet President Trump in Doha.

Overview

  • Edan Alexander, captured by Hamas during the October 2023 Gaza incursion, was released today after 580 days of captivity.
  • The handover occurred via the Red Cross at Khan Yunis, with Alexander now at the IDF's Re’im base for medical checks and family reunification.
  • Hamas described the release as a goodwill gesture tied to broader negotiations for a ceasefire and prisoner exchanges.
  • President Trump welcomed the release as a positive step, with plans for Alexander to meet him in Doha alongside his family.
  • Despite the temporary ceasefire for the transfer, Israel has signaled no pause in its military operations, aiming to sustain pressure on Hamas.
